Meet Facilities Manager – Holly La Barre

Holly La Barre – Facilities Manager

Holly has been riding and working with horses all her life. With a riding instructor for a Mom and a Dad that rode as well, there was never a time when Holly was not immersed in horses. As a child she started out trail riding and at age 5 took an overnight trail ride from a farm that used to sit where White Marsh mall now resides to Cub Hill Stables which is now Graham Equestrian Center!
   At age 9 Holly’s started showing A rated  pony hunters for a top hunter farm in Harford county. At age 14 she was breaking young Thoroughbreds and getting them ready for the track. That sparked a 10 year career in the racing industry where she worked on many Maryland racing farms in every aspect of Thoroughbred care including breeding, foaling, nutrition, starting young horses, galloping, training and injury care.
   Holly’s newest love is dressage and low level eventing but she likes to keep herself and her horses on their toes by competing in many different equine sports and activities such as endurance and competitive riding, jousting, judge pleasure trail rides, hunter shows, western pleasure, parades and drill teams. As much as Holly loves competing her very favorite thing to do with her horses is to go for a nice long weekend camping trip.
        Holly has been managing Graham from the start and has loved seeing the place grow from a boarding facility to a true educational center where everyone can come and learn. Holly is also CHA certified.
